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95164497 33 53484521542 25116506166 880
78 95142760671 6030
78 95142760671 6030
91958 439084025 857752726
All about undefined
Interested in learning more?
78 95142760671 6030
91958 439084025 857752726
See more
13 449315458 2736067717
46705820 59 99386618442
See more
030344548 10 2764991
18122980 751533 54 68 947476309
See more